Комментирование в запросе на вытягивание - документация GitHub Enterprise Server 39 | Найти информацию на GitHub

Комментирование в запросе на вытягивание - документация GitHub Enterprise Server 39 | Найти информацию на GitHub
На чтение
30 мин.
Просмотров
46
Дата обновления
26.02.2025
#COURSE##INNER#

Комментирование в запросе на вытягивание - это важная функция, предлагаемая GitHub Enterprise Server 39. Эта функция позволяет пользователям оставлять комментарии и отзывы к коду, который был предложен на включение в основную ветку репозитория. Таким образом, разработчики и коллеги могут общаться, обсуждать, задавать вопросы и делиться своим мнением о предложенных изменениях. Такой подход стимулирует коллективную работу и улучшает качество программного кода.

Комментирование в запросе на вытягивание осуществляется путем добавления комментариев к конкретным строкам кода или же к всему файлу. Комментарий может быть написан в произвольной форме, но рекомендуется соблюдать некоторые правила этикета для более удобного и ясного взаимодействия. Например, можно использовать теги форматирования текста для выделения важных моментов или для ссылок на другие строки кода или задачи в системе управления проектами.

При комментировании в запросе на вытягивание также можно упоминать других пользователей или команды, добавляя символ @ перед их именем. Это позволит уведомить указанных участников о существенных изменениях и привлечь их внимание к определенным местам кода, которые требуют внимания или исправлений. Такое упоминание будет отображено в уведомлениях и позволит всем заинтересованным сторонам быть в курсе и активно участвовать в обсуждении и разработке проекта.

Основы комментирования

Вот некоторые основные принципы комментирования в запросе на вытягивание:

  • Будьте вежливы и уважительны. Всегда помните, что пишете для реальных людей, и ваш комментарий может быть прочитан всей командой.
  • Будьте ясны и конкретны. Пишите так, чтобы ваши комментарии были понятными и легко интерпретируемыми.
  • Предлагайте альтернативы и улучшения. Если вы видите, что можно сделать что-то по-другому или лучше, предложите свои идеи и аргументы.
  • Уточняйте суть вопроса. Если что-то не ясно или вы хотите получить больше информации, не стесняйтесь задавать вопросы.
  • Уделяйте внимание коду. Если ваш комментарий относится к определенной части кода, укажите на нее, чтобы другие участники команды могли быстро найти нужное место.

Помните, что комментарии в запросе на вытягивание могут дополняться и изменяться в процессе обсуждения. Будьте готовы отвечать на вопросы, уточнять детали и поддерживать конструктивный диалог.

Роль комментариев в процессе разработки

Комментарии помогают разработчикам лучше понять код и его функциональность, особенно когда работают с чужими проектами или взаимодействуют с другими членами команды. Комментарии могут содержать пояснения к сложному коду, описания алгоритмов, объяснения логики работы программы и т. д.

Кроме того, комментарии могут быть полезными для документирования кода. Они могут содержать информацию о назначении классов, функций, переменных и т. д. Такая документация помогает другим разработчикам быстрее разобраться в коде, узнать, какие функции делает программа и какие данные она обрабатывает.

Также комментарии могут играть важную роль при отладке кода. Разработчики могут использовать комментарии, чтобы временно отключить определенные части кода, чтобы проверить, в чем проблема. Комментарии также могут помочь разработчикам отметить места в коде, которые нуждаются в дальнейшей доработке или исправлении.

Важно помнить, что комментарии должны быть информативными и читабельными. Они должны быть написаны на языке, понятном другим разработчикам, и содержать достаточно информации, чтобы разработчики могли быстро разобраться в коде. Также комментарии следует регулярно обновлять и поддерживать синхронизацию соответствующего кода.

Преимущества хорошего комментирования

  • Улучшает понимание кода: Комментарии упрощают понимание кода другим разработчикам и помогают им разобраться в его функциональности. Хорошо прокомментированный код легче читать и поддерживать.
  • Снижает время отладки: Хорошо расположенные комментарии помогают быстро разобраться в коде и избежать ошибок. Пояснения и пояснения к переменным и функциям помогают предотвратить возникновение ошибок во время отладки.
  • Улучшает сотрудничество: Комментарии помогают разработчикам лучше сотрудничать и обмениваться информацией. Хорошо прокомментированный код делает его более доступным для других членов команды, а также помогает в процессе код-ревью.
  • Сохраняет контекст: Комментарии актуализируют контекст кода и объясняют его назначение. Это особенно полезно в ситуациях, когда разработчикам приходится возвращаться к коду после продолжительного перерыва.
  • Способствует документированию: Комментарии могут служить как форма документации кода. Хорошо прокомментированный код может быстро изучить новыми разработчиками и помочь им начать работу над проектом.

Комментирование в запросах на вытягивание помогает подчеркнуть важность хорошего комментирования в совместной разработке и повысить качество кода.

Как комментировать запрос на вытягивание

Если вы хотите оставить комментарий в запросе на вытягивание, выполните следующие шаги:

  1. Откройте страницу запроса на вытягивание.
  2. Прокрутите страницу вниз до раздела "Комментарии".
  3. В поле для написания комментария напишите свой комментарий.
  4. Нажмите кнопку "Оставить комментарий", чтобы добавить комментарий к запросу на вытягивание.

Вы также можете отвечать на комментарии других пользователей, используя функциональность комментирования. Просто выберите комментарий, на который вы хотите ответить, и нажмите кнопку "Ответить". Ваш комментарий будет отображаться под выбранным комментарием и будет автоматически связан с ним.

Комментарии в запросе на вытягивание могут помочь улучшить качество кода, устранить ошибки, уточнить детали или принять решение о слиянии изменений. Благодаря комментариям сотрудники могут эффективно сотрудничать и совместно работать над проектом.

Важно: При использовании комментирования в запросе на вытягивание рекомендуется соблюдать этикет и хорошие манеры общения. Будьте вежливы, конструктивны и уважительны к другим пользователям. Избегайте провокаций, оскорблений и нецензурных выражений. Помните, что ваш комментарий виден всем участникам проекта и может оказывать влияние на окончательное решение по запросу на вытягивание.

Комментирование в запросе на вытягивание - это мощный инструмент для совместной работы и обсуждения изменений в проекте. Используйте его с умом и с уважением к другим участникам команды.

Описание проблемы или предлагаемого изменения

В этом разделе вы должны чётко описать проблему или изменение, которое вы предлагаете.

Убедитесь, что ваше описание ясно и лаконично. Объясните, какая проблема возникла или что вы бы хотели изменить, чтобы улучшить функциональность, безопасность или общую производительность.

Если это проблема, укажите, что произошло и почему оно является проблемой. Если это изменение, обьясните, почему вы считаете, что оно улучшит функциональность и как будет сделан перевоплощенное изменение.

Обоснование сделанных изменений

В данном разделе представлено обоснование проведенных изменений в запросе на вытягивание. Здесь разъясняется необходимость и цель внесенных правок, а также поясняются выбранные подходы и принятые решения.

В процессе анализа исходного кода были выявлены несколько уязвимостей и недочетов. Для разработки веб-приложений критически важно обеспечить безопасность данных и защиту от возможных атак. Таким образом, основной целью внесенных изменений было исправление обнаруженных уязвимостей с целью повышения безопасности приложения.

Во-первых, была проведена проверка на уязвимости связанные с инъекцией кода. Были добавлены необходимые проверки и эскейп-последовательности для предотвращения атаки через ввод кода в пользовательские поля. Это позволило улучшить защиту и исключить возможность выполнения вредоносного кода на сервере.

Во-вторых, было внесено изменение в алгоритм хэширования паролей пользователей. В предыдущей версии алгоритм не обеспечивал должный уровень безопасности, и у пользователей была возможность использовать слабые пароли. Внесенные изменения заключаются в усилении алгоритма хэширования и добавлении соли для улучшения защиты паролей пользователей.

Также были внесены некоторые улучшения в интерфейс пользователя для повышения его удобства и интуитивности. Были изменены цветовая гамма и шрифты, что обеспечило более приятное визуальное восприятие приложения. Кроме того, были исправлены некоторые опечатки и грамматические ошибки, что повысило качество и понятность текстовых элементов.

Предлагаемые тесты и проверки

При комментировании в запросе на вытягивание можно предложить следующие тесты и проверки:

  • Провести тестирование функциональности кода на разных операционных системах.
  • Проверить, что все требования к коду и стилю оформления были соблюдены.
  • Выявить и исправить потенциальные ошибки и уязвимости в коде.
  • Убедиться, что новый код не приводит к непредвиденным побочным эффектам.
  • Проверить, что новая функциональность не ломает уже существующий функционал.
  • Протестировать новый код в системе реального времени для определения производительности и возможных узких мест.
  • Убедиться, что новый код не вызывает проблем совместимости с другими компонентами системы.

Предложение тестов и проверок в комментариях позволяет найти и исправить ошибки на ранних этапах разработки, что способствует более качественному и стабильному коду.

Лучшие практики комментирования

1. Будьте конкретными и ясными:

Комментарии должны быть понятными и конкретными. Избегайте составления комментариев, которые несут мало информации или имеют двусмысленность. Укажите на то, что именно изменяется или исправляется в коде.

2. Комментируйте сложные участки кода:

Если у вас есть сложный участок кода, который может вызвать путаницу, добавьте комментарии, объясняющие, что и зачем выполняется. Это поможет другим разработчикам быстрее разобраться в коде и избежать ошибок.

3. Игнорируйте очевидное:

Если код очевиден, нет необходимости добавлять комментарии, которые просто повторяют то, что уже ясно из самого кода. Фокусируйтесь на важной информации и деталях, которые могут не быть явными для других разработчиков.

4. Используйте правильное форматирование:

Для улучшения читаемости комментариев используйте правильное форматирование и отступы. Это поможет сделать код более читаемым и понятным для других разработчиков.

5. Будьте вежливыми и почтительными:

Комментирование не только помогает улучшить понимание кода, но и способствует созданию положительной и продуктивной атмосферы. Будьте вежливыми и почтительными в своих комментариях, даже если вы не согласны с предложенными изменениями. Используйте комментарии для обсуждения и предложения улучшений, а не для критики или оскорблений.

6. Обновляйте комментарии при изменении кода:

Помните, что код может меняться со временем. Поэтому важно обновлять комментарии при внесении изменений в код, чтобы они оставались актуальными и информативными.

Следуя этим лучшим практикам, вы сможете сделать комментирование в запросе на вытягивание более эффективным и полезным для всех разработчиков!

Использование понятных и информативных комментариев

В комментариях к запросу на вытягивание очень важно использовать понятные и информативные сообщения, чтобы помочь членам команды разобраться в изменениях, которые вы вносите в код.

Вот несколько советов по использованию понятных и информативных комментариев:

1. Будьте специфичными: Ваш комментарий должен четко указывать, в чем заключаются изменения, чтобы другим разработчикам не приходилось догадываться, что вы пытаетесь сделать.

2. Используйте ключевые слова: Использование ключевых слов поможет сделать ваш комментарий более понятным и легким для поиска. Примеры ключевых слов могут включать "исправление ошибки", "добавление функции", "оптимизация кода" и т. д.

3. Дайте контекст: Пожалуйста, объясните свои изменения и причины, которые вас привели к этим решениям. Это поможет другим разработчикам быстро понять ваше видение и намерения.

4. Используйте шаблоны: Если ваш комментарий содержит повторяющуюся информацию, вы можете использовать шаблоны, чтобы упростить процесс написания комментариев и сократить количество кода.

Помните, что понятные и информативные комментарии помогают содействовать эффективной командной работе и делают код более доступным для сопровождения. Будьте тактичны и сознательны при написании комментариев, чтобы помочь вашей команде быть в курсе производимых изменений.

Вопрос-ответ:

Как комментировать запрос на вытягивание на GitHub Enterprise Server 39?

Для комментирования запроса на вытягивание на GitHub Enterprise Server 39 нужно перейти на страницу запроса на вытягивание и нажать на кнопку "Добавить комментарий" под комментариями.

Можно ли добавить комментарий к комментарию в запросе на вытягивание на GitHub Enterprise Server 39?

Да, можно добавить комментарий к комментарию в запросе на вытягивание на GitHub Enterprise Server 39. Для этого нужно нажать на кнопку "Reply" под комментарием, на который вы хотите ответить, и написать свой комментарий.

Как отредактировать свой комментарий в запросе на вытягивание на GitHub Enterprise Server 39?

Чтобы отредактировать свой комментарий в запросе на вытягивание на GitHub Enterprise Server 39, нужно навести курсор на свой комментарий и нажать на иконку карандаша, которая появится справа. Затем можно внести необходимые изменения и сохранить их.

Как удалить комментарий в запросе на вытягивание на GitHub Enterprise Server 39?

Чтобы удалить комментарий в запросе на вытягивание на GitHub Enterprise Server 39, нужно навести курсор на комментарий и нажать на иконку корзины, которая появится справа. После этого будет предложено подтвердить удаление комментария.

Могу ли я подписаться на комментарии в запросе на вытягивание на GitHub Enterprise Server 39?

Да, вы можете подписаться на комментарии в запросе на вытягивание на GitHub Enterprise Server 39. Для этого вам нужно нажать на кнопку "Subscribe" под комментариями и выбрать настройки подписки по своему усмотрению.

Что такое комментирование в запросе на вытягивание?

Комментирование в запросе на вытягивание - это возможность оставлять комментарии и обсуждать изменения, предложенные в запросе на вытягивание, на платформе GitHub Enterprise Server.

Видео:

0 Комментариев
Комментариев на модерации: 0
Оставьте комментарий